Industrial Series Desktop Compendium in The Manner of Andre Guilmet

About the Item

A very stylish late nineteenth century desk clock with integrated compass, reminiscent of the Industrial series of clocks by Andre Guilmet. The eight day movement governed by a cylinder escapement, behind a two tone roman dial with matted central section. The blued steel hands are of the form commonly used by Guilmet. The bronzed case is mounted on a plinth with polished brass mounts formin the feet and carrying handle. Above the dial is a Compass set into the case. This clock dates from the last quarter of the nineteenth century and bares many of the hallmarks of Andre Guilmet’s industrial series.
